Italian Side Dishes – Easy Italian Vegetable and Pasta Sides

Italian cuisine is known for its bold flavors and comforting meals, but the side dishes often steal the show with their simple ingredients and effortless charm.

In this collection of Italian side dishes, you’ll find easy-to-make recipes that highlight fresh vegetables, fragrant herbs, olive oil, and classic Mediterranean seasonings. From roasted vegetables and light salads to cozy potato dishes and rustic bean sides, each recipe brings a taste of Italy to your table without requiring complicated steps.

These sides pair beautifully with pasta, chicken, seafood, and grilled meats, making them perfect for weeknight dinners, weekend cooking, and everything in between.
